The class ventured to Grow Food Northampton for our first mapping mission last week, fully experiencing “if you don’t like the weather in New England now, just wait a few minutes.” In order to execute successful drone missions, we consult a checklist that is regularly updated. We asked the class to reflect on their first mission and develop their own checklists based on these questions:
- What is a checklist item that you found to be particular important based on your experience at Grow Food Northampton? Please explain in 2-3 sentences.
- What is an item missing from your checklist that would be important to include and why?
- What is a checklist item that is not on the Spatial Analysis Lab’s checklist, and why should we include it in future missions?
All the submissions demonstrated careful research and considerations; the students emphasized and added these checklist items:
- Preparation:
- Towel or paper towel
- Spare drone
- Pen and notebook
- Verify any software/firmware updates
- Prior to take-off:
- Keep other equipment away from launch point
- Check the weather regularly
- Format SD card
- Clean camera lens
- Audibly declare “Arming”
- If indoors, check GPS/sensors that may interfere with flight
- After landing:
- If uneven landing, do equipment check
- Dry/clean off drone with towel
